Subject: Stale-cache postmortem — action items

Team,

Short version: the Oakmere edge cache served stale pricing for 40 minutes after Friday's deploy because the invalidation hook in Cindervane never fired. Fix is merged; TTL fallback reduced to 5 minutes as a guard. On-call: if you see pricing drift alerts, purge the edge tier first, ask questions second. Full writeup on the wiki by Thursday. The patched release is identified by the token below.

pipeline stamp: htk31_0320b403a7d85d795607a9e75b13f71

## Alert: StatRelay Sidecar Flush Lag

This alert fires when the StatRelay metrics-aggregation sidecar falls more than 120 seconds behind on flushing buffered samples to the Coalmine backend. Plugin-emitted counters are buffered in-process, so sustained lag usually means a plugin is emitting unbounded label cardinality or blocking the flush thread. Check your plugin's metric registration against the published cardinality limits before escalating. If the lag persists after your plugin is ruled out, contact the telemetry team.

escalation mailbox, bagug-fahof: novdor.wendor.jormir@norvalabs.example

## Build Provenance: Bulk Edits in the Admin Table

At Norvane Digital, every bulk edit applied through the Ledgerpane admin table must be traceable to the build that executed it. The audit daemon records the operator role, row count, and rollback snapshot for each batch. New contractors should verify provenance before approving a bulk change. Each audit entry is stamped with the token shown below.

session token of tajef-bageg = htk21_5d90d574934f3ccae6437